What Credit Card Skimmers Look Like . credit card skimming is a form of theft that occurs when someone installs a small electronic device, known as a credit card skimmer, into a card. credit card skimmers are devices that allow thieves to steal card data and use it for fraudulent activities. One of the ways to test for credit card skimmers is by pulling on the credit card slot. what does a credit card skimmer look like? while credit card skimmers can vary in design, they typically tend to be small, discreet devices that are either attached to or fit over a payment terminals' card reader slot, according to josh amishav, founder and ceo of the data breach monitoring platform breachsense. Skimmers come in various shapes and sizes, most of which are hard to spot. threat actors use skimmers to scan the information on a victim’s debit or credit card so they can commit credit card fraud or create counterfeit cards to sell on the dark web. Credit card skimmers are designed to look like they’re part of the pos system they’re attached to. what does a skimmer look like?
